 Jesus lives in sermons we don't want to hear.
I am a "preacher" and I love to preach.  I could preach to you just about anytime and sometimes I slip into preacher mode accidentally when I'm excited or passionate about something.  Most the time people are kind enough to just let me preach at them, sometimes they roll their eyes, sometimes they just tell me to knock it off. 

Today I got preached to.  I have these big interviews on Thursday.  It's my final step towards ordination if I pass.  If I don't pass there are two options.  I could be told "no" which means "go away - you're never going to be a pastor."  More likely I could be told to "wait" and come back in a couple years having re-written everything and done it all over.  Somehow the people on this board think that "wait" is some kind of friendly idea and that it is really a very good thing to be told.  My idea about that is "YEAH RIGHT".  But I hear that nearly 70% of the people get told to wait every year.  So I'm keeping an open mind about the whole thing.

One of the board members called me and began to tell me how God lives in the "wait" and that God might be using this time for some sort of spiritual formation.  I'm a pastor too...I would have said the same thing to somebody else...but when I hear it I want to both roll my eyes and throw up all at once.  I wonder how many times I've given somebody some heartfelt advice only to have them feel like throwing up or rolling there eyes at me. 

Jesus lived in those words - words that I needed to hear but hope I don't have to.  Jesus is bigger than I can even imagine and I'm so thankful for that - Jesus is bigger than this process and bigger than the Church.  I just hope I can spread a little Jesus to somebody else.
